Under contract after multiple offers!!!

So very excited I just have to share.  The last 3 days have been a crazy series of events for me.  My realtor emailed a new listing to me on Friday while I was on vacation.  Viewed home at 1pm on Sunday (along with 15 other parties in the first 30 minutes).  Completed a pre-inspection Sunday at 5pm.  Offered on the home Monday afternoon.  They were holding all offers until 5pm on Monday; there were 8 offers in total (wow how this market has turned around in the past few months).  I heard this morning that I was in the top 3 of 8 offers.  While I felt like I'd put the best offer I had forward before, with significant escalations, I added $3k more to the offer price.   And..... That was enough!  Under contract!

 I'm so incredibly excited!  It turns out that the house is owned by a family who raised their children in this house for the past 30 years.  And my boyfriend was in boyscouts with their sons.  I'm still amazed that a strong offer, a letter about purchasing my first home, the boyscout connection, and raising our future children there helped me beat out another buyer that would have offered $12k more!

 Now for another 4 weeks of craziness.  1 day neighborhood review for sewer inspection tomorrow, 15 days to complete financing, and a 30 day close.  Hopefully I make it through this all!  This forum has been an incredible resource over the past 6 months, so grateful for technology connecting strangers.
